In an era marked by profound religious upheaval, "The Pulpit of the Reformation, Nos. 1, 2, 3 and 4" by Welch, Knox, and Latimer captures the fervent spirit of reformative thought. This compelling collection presents powerful sermons that delve into themes of judgment and morality, echoing the transformative ideals that shaped modern faith. With each discourse, the authors challenge readers to reflect on the essence of belief and the role of divine justice in human affairs. Ideal for students, civic activists, and historians alike, this document serves as a crucial resource for understanding the theological debates that influenced the Reformation.
